Celebrate St Patrick's Day in Kuala Lumpur

Just as beer is to Octoberfest, Guinness brew is to St Patrick's Day - celebrated worldwide on March 17. Here in Malaysia, Guinness Anchor Berhad is taking the festivity to a whole new level this year by bringing St Patrick's Day fun to last the whole of March.

This is the fifth year Guinness is hosting this enjoyable and renowned festivity in Malaysia with a wide array of street parties and fun activities. So keep a lookout for the entertaining activities and consumer promotions.

In line with the celebrations, Guinness is bringing 36 parties across the country to places like the Klang Valley, Penang, Johor Bahru, Malacca, Ipoh, Kuantan, Kota Kinabalu, Miri and Kuching.

The celebration, themed “Merry Goes Round in March”, will culminate in its most exciting showcase at Changkat Bukit Bintang on March 17 where there will be street entertainers, dances and buskers livening up the party giving revellers a taste of the global party experience as celebrated in other major cities around the world.
